NEW! Skype Video Conferencing Training
Would you like to provide training for your teachers, but schedule and budget are obstacles?
Do you want follow-up personalized training for certain teachers?
Are you the only theatre teacher and would like personal assistance?
We now provide web-based video conferencing as a tool for staff development. Individuals or groups can receive customized training from one or multiple locations at the same time. Games, techniques, and teaching strategies can be demonstrated live with video conferencing. Lessons, product details, and bonus material can be displayed directly on your computer screen. Skype training is billed on an hourly basis and is completely customized to your needs.

Benefits of Training With Video Conferencing
• Great for individuals or small groups from one or multiple locations
• Save money: pay only for the training time (no travel expenses)
• Quick and easy scheduling; much less advance planning required
• The "Share Screen" feature allows us to demonstrate program details and highlight specific text
• Works between any computers with web cam and internet access
• Free software and free video-conference calls from Skype
• Get quality teacher training from anywhere in the world
